/**
* A transliterator that converts Unicode escape forms to the
* characters they represent. Escape forms have a prefix, a suffix, a
* radix, and minimum and maximum digit counts.
*
* <p>This class is package private. It registers several standard
* variants with the system which are then accessed via their IDs.
*
* @author Alan Liu
*/
class U_I18N_API UnescapeTransliterator : public Transliterator {
private:
/**
* The encoded pattern specification. The pattern consists of
* zero or more forms. Each form consists of a prefix, suffix,
* radix, minimum digit count, and maximum digit count. These
* values are stored as a five character header. That is, their
* numeric values are cast to 16-bit characters and stored in the
* string. Following these five characters, the prefix
* characters, then suffix characters are stored. Each form thus
* takes n+5 characters, where n is the total length of the prefix
* and suffix. The end is marked by a header of length one
* consisting of the character END.
*/
UChar* spec; // owned; may not be NULL
